Introduction

Choosing the right underground electrical conduit affects installation cost, efficiency, and cable safety. MPP conduit and M-PVC conduit are widely used in power cable protection systems, but they serve different construction methods.

MPP vs M-PVC Overview

MPP Conduit

  • Used for trenchless HDD installation
  • High tensile strength
  • Better heat resistance
  • Ideal for road crossing projects

M-PVC Conduit

  • Used for open trench burial
  • High rigidity
  • Cost-effective
  • Suitable for cable ducting

Main Difference

The key difference is installation method, not voltage level.

Engineering guideline: MPP conduit is used for trenchless installation where pulling strength is required, while M-PVC conduit is used for direct burial where rigidity and cost efficiency matter.
